реклама
разместить

3 совета от разработчика с опытом 10+ лет

Среди разработчиков только и разговоров, что о море и о коде... Или есть еще кое-что, что полезно бы знать про разработку? Три топовых совета от программиста со стажем:

3 совета от разработчика с опытом 10+ лет

1. Умение писать хороший код не гарантирует тебе успехов. Людей, которые умеют писать код очень много. И в целом нет ничего плохого в том, что кто-то подходит к IDE как работяга к станку на заводе. Но реально ценится умение видеть картину целиком и принимать верные решения. Если ты не понимаешь своей предметной области, то вряд ли ты сможешь достичь каких-то высот.

2. Не менее важно умение признавать, что ты не всесильный. Ты можешь провалить все дедлайны, и в большинстве случаев это не станет проблемой. Проблемой станет то, что твой руководитель узнал об этом слишком поздно. Однако, не забывай, что когда ты говоришь «я не умею делать этого» от тебя ждут, что ты хоть и с опозданием, но все же разберешься и закроешь задачу. Признание недостаточности твоих скилов не снимает магическим образом с тебя всю ответственность. Оно просто дает тебе больше времени.

3. Если тебе иногда кажется, что программирование это не твое, то так оно и есть. Многие пришли в профессию за деньгами наслушавшись советов родственников и друзей. Но если ты не горишь этим, скорее всего ты всегда будешь отставать от своих коллег. Не волнуйся, тебе не обязательно уходить из IT. Попробуй себя в тестировании, анализе или менеджменте. IT сфера гораздо шире, чем ты думаешь. Поверь, хороший тестировщик всегда будет цениться больше, чем плохой программист

реклама
разместить
Начать дискуссию
Мне предложили +30% к окладу и IT-льготы, но я отказался. 3 причины, почему за такими плюсами прячут адские условия

Рассказываю, как распознать работодателя, который выжмет из вас все соки, и не купиться на «золотую клетку».

Мне предложили +30% к окладу и IT-льготы, но я отказался. 3 причины, почему за такими плюсами прячут адские условия
1919
Топ 10 ошибок, которые мешают стать программистом: разбор ключевых проблем новичков
Топ 10 ошибок, которые мешают стать программистом: разбор ключевых проблем новичков
11
Двойные стандарты в деловых отношениях: когда клиенты требуют мгновенной реакции, но забывают о своих обязательствах

Однако нередко возникает парадоксальная ситуация: клиенты требуют от исполнителей молниеносной реакции, безупречного соблюдения сроков и дотошного выполнения каждого пункта договора, но при этом сами позволяют себе затягивать обратную связь, проверку документов или оплату.

Двойные стандарты в деловых отношениях: когда клиенты требуют мгновенной реакции, но забывают о своих обязательствах
Уволился с позиции тимлида и снова стал разработчиком
Уволился с позиции тимлида и снова стал разработчиком
11
Мой ответ на вопрос КАКИМ ПРОЕКТОМ ВЫ ГОРДИТЕСЬ? Работает ВСЕГДА на 100%
ТОП 5 инвестиционных инструментов для ПРОГРАММИСТА. Делай ИКСЫ не меняя работу!
11
Эффективное управление файлами: лучшие практики и инструменты

Почему современному файловому хранилищу жизненно необходима экосистема расширений? Какие инструменты действительно полезны, и как это реализовано в NextBox?

Эффективное управление файлами: лучшие практики и инструменты
22
Как «технический долг» становятся причиной кадрового кризиса и что с этим делать?

В мире технологий все чаще всплывают истории о компаниях, которые годами игнорируют модернизацию продукта и застревают в бесконечном болоте устаревших языков программирования, сомнительных фреймворков и «технического долга».

Как «технический долг» становятся причиной кадрового кризиса и что с этим делать?
22
Senior программисты или junior разработчики?
11
реклама
разместить
Как не бросить программирование на середине пути

Программирование — это увлекательная и перспективная область, открывающая множество возможностей для профессионального и личного роста. Однако многие новички сталкиваются с трудностями, которые могут привести к утрате мотивации и желанию прекратить обучение. В этой статье мы рассмотрим ключевые стратегии, которые помогут вам преодолеть препятствия…

Как не бросить программирование на середине пути
Нужно ли будет знание программирования в эпоху искусственного интеллекта?

Сейчас все больше распространяется мнение, что не нужно. Билл Гейтс — не последний человек в мире технологий, да и ИИ, визионер и технооптимист – ответил на вопросы в рамках презентации своей книги «Исходный код». И его ответы отнюдь нетривиальны, аргументация – убедительна (по крайней мере, для меня).

Билл Гейтс и Пол Аллен (сидят) у телетайпа во время учебы в школе Лейксайд. <a href="https://api.vc.ru/v2.8/redirect?to=https%3A%2F%2Fwww.axios.com%2F2025%2F02%2F03%2Fbill-gates-coding-matters-generative-ai&postId=1791360" rel="nofollow noreferrer noopener" target="_blank">Источник</a>. <br />
33
Парадокс выбора: как не застрять, когда нужно принять важное решение

Знаете раньше выбрать то, чем ты хочешь заниматься было намного проще.

Парадокс выбора: как не застрять, когда нужно принять важное решение